Terrarium Question
I am getting a terrarium that is 48in long 18in deep and 17in tall, and I was wondering if anyone can tell me how big of a hood do I need to get and what would be a good uva/uvb bulb to get and how big of a heat lamp should I get and how many watts do I need.

you will need at least a 100W spot basking bulb, maybe an Under Tank Heater if your house is cold. Put the UV light inside the tank by the basking spot. Change the temp by raising and lowering the basking spot.

It depends on what type of light youare going to go with. If flourescent you will need a 2 tube fixture, 48 inches long to cover the entire tank length. The bulb is the reptisun 5.0 or iguana light 5.0(same bulb different package). You will also need to provide a basking area that will get the animals within 12 inches of the bulbs.
Mercury vapors only require a dome like a basking light, put out a lot more UVB at greater distances from the bulb and will not require you to use the 12 inch minimum distance. I would suggest checking out the ReptileUV link on our homepage. These are the state of the art in UVB bulbs. You can get them that do or do not produce heat. For heat for a cage that size I would recommend a ceramic heating element. Puts out a lot of warmth but no light so you don't have to worry about a supplemental heat source at night if the room is too cool.
